WebJun 29, 2015 · Initially, the color of the blood within the eye appears bright red. The blood may remain unclotted and settle on the floor of the eye. The blood may also clot and turn dark brown or bluish-black with time. The … WebJan 22, 2009 · The most common signs of red eye in cats is redness and inflammation affecting one or both eyes. Causes.
